The total number of deaths is now 1,920. 603,072 COVID-19 tests have been administered. The overall total number of positive COVID-19 cases is now 74,635, including 3 delayed reported cases. A new case is defined as a positive test within the last 72-hours. Some cases are due to delayed reporting from the states.
